The tests can precisely quantify protein levels, but they also require hours of work by trained technicians and specialized equipment. That makes them prohibitively expensive, driving up the costs of drugs and putting research testing out of reach for many.<\/span><\/p>\n<p><span style=\"font-weight: 400\">Now the Advanced Silicon Group (ASG), founded by Marcie Black \u201994, MEng \u201995, PhD \u201903 and Bill Rever, is commercializing a new technology that could dramatically lower the time and costs associated with protein sensing. ASG\u2019s proprietary sensor combines silicon nanowires with antibodies that can bind to different proteins to create a highly sensitive measurement of their concentration in a given solution.<\/span><\/p>\n<p><span style=\"font-weight: 400\">The tests can measure the concentration of many different proteins and other molecules at once, with results typically available in less than 15 minutes. Users simply place a tiny amount of solution on the sensor, rinse the sensor, and then insert it into ASG\u2019s handheld testing system.<\/span><\/p>\n<p><span style=\"font-weight: 400\">\u201cWe\u2019re making it 15 times faster and 15 times lower cost to test for proteins,\u201d Black says. \u201cThat\u2019s on the drug development side. This could also make the manufacturing of drugs significantly faster and more cost-effective. It could revolutionize how we create drugs in this country and around the world.\u201d<\/span><\/p>\n<p><span style=\"font-weight: 400\">Since developing its sensor, ASG\u2019s team has received inquiries from a long list of people interested in using them to develop new therapeutics, help elite athletes train, and understand soil concentrations in agriculture, among other applications.<\/span><\/p>\n<p><span style=\"font-weight: 400\">For now, though, the small company is focusing on lowering barriers in health care by selling its low-cost sensors to companies developing and manufacturing drugs.<\/span><\/p>\n<p><span style=\"font-weight: 400\">\u201cRight now, money is a limiting factor in researching and creating new drugs,\u201d explains Marissa Gillis, a member of ASG\u2019s team.<\/span><b>\u00a0<\/b><span style=\"font-weight: 400\">\u201cMaking these processes faster and less costly could dramatically increase the amount of biologic testing and creation. It also makes it more viable for companies to develop drugs for rare conditions with smaller markets.\u201d<\/span><\/p>\n<h2><b>A family away from home<\/b><\/h2>\n<p><span style=\"font-weight: 400\">Black grew up in a small town in Ohio before coming to MIT for three degrees in electrical engineering.<\/span><\/p>\n<p><span style=\"font-weight: 400\">\u201cGoing to MIT changed my life,\u201d Black says. \u201cIt opened my eyes to the possibilities of doing science and engineering to make the world a better place. Black couldn\u2019t always afford to go home for holidays, so she\u2019d spend Thanksgivings with the Dresselhaus family.<\/span><\/p>\n<p><span style=\"font-weight: 400\">\u201cMillie was an amazing person, and her family was a family away from home for me,\u201d Black says. \u201cMillie continued to be my mentor \u2014 and I hear she did this with a lot of students \u2014 until the day she died.\u201d<\/span><\/p>\n<p><span style=\"font-weight: 400\">For her thesis, Black studied the optical properties of nanowires, which taught her about the nanostructures and optoelectronics she\u2019d eventually use as part of the Advanced Silicon Group.<\/span><\/p>\n<p><span style=\"font-weight: 400\">Following graduation, Black worked at the Los Alamos National Laboratory before founding the company Bandgap Engineering, which developed efficient, low-cost nanostructured solar cells. That technology was subsequently commercialized by other companies and became the subject of a patent dispute. In 2015, Black spun out the Advanced Silicon Group to apply a similar technology to protein sensing.<\/span><\/p>\n<p><span style=\"font-weight: 400\">ASG\u2019s sensors combine known approaches for sensitizing silicon to biological molecules, using the photoelectric properties of silicon nanowires to detect proteins electrically.<\/span><\/p>\n<p><span style=\"font-weight: 400\">\u201cIt\u2019s basically a solar cell that we functionalize with an antibody that\u2019s specific to a certain protein,\u201d Black says. \u201cWhen the protein gets close, it brings an electrical charge with it that will repel light carriers inside the silicon, and doing that changes how well the electron and the holes can recombine. By looking at the photocurrent when you\u2019re exposed to a solution, you can tell how much protein is bound to the surface and thus the concentration of that protein.\u201d<\/span><\/p>\n<p><span style=\"font-weight: 400\">ASG was accepted into MIT.nano\u2019s START.nano startup accelerator and MIT\u2019s Office of Corporate Relations Startup Exchange Program soon after its founding, which gave Black\u2019s team access to cutting-edge equipment at MIT and connected her with potential investors and partners.<\/span><\/p>\n<p><span style=\"font-weight: 400\">Black has also received broad support from MIT\u2019s Venture Mentoring Service and worked with researchers from MIT\u2019s Microsystems Technology Laboratories (MTL), where she conducted research as a student.<\/span><\/p>\n<p><span style=\"font-weight: 400\">\u201cEven though the company is in Lowell, [Massachusetts], I\u2019m constantly going to MIT and getting help from professors and researchers at MIT,\u201d Black says.<\/span><\/p>\n<h2><b>Biosensing for impact<\/b><\/h2>\n<p><span style=\"font-weight: 400\">From extensive discussions with people in the pharmaceutical industry, Black learned about the need for a more affordable protein-measurement tool. During drug development and manufacturing, protein levels must be measured to detect problems such as contamination from host cell proteins, which can be fatal to patients even at very low quantities.<\/span><\/p>\n<p><span style=\"font-weight: 400\">\u201cIt can cost more than $1 billion to develop a drug,\u201d Black says. \u201cA big part of the process is bioprocessing, and 50 to 80 percent of bioprocessing is dedicated to purifying these unwanted proteins. That challenge leads to drugs being more expensive and taking longer to get to market.\u201d<\/span><\/p>\n<p><span style=\"font-weight: 400\">ASG has since worked with researchers to develop tests for biomarkers associated with lung cancer and dormant tuberculosis and has received multiple grants from the National Science Foundation, the National Institute of Standards and Technology, and the commonwealth of Massachusetts, including funding to develop tests for host cell proteins.<\/span><\/p>\n<p><span style=\"font-weight: 400\">This year, ASG announced a partnership with Axogen to help the regenerative nerve repair company grow nerve tissue.<\/span><\/p>\n<p><span style=\"font-weight: 400\">\u201cThere\u2019s a lot of interest in using our sensor for applications in regenerative medicine,\u201d Black says. \u201cAnother example we envision is if you\u2019re sick in rural India and there\u2019s no doctor nearby, you can show up at a clinic, nurses can give this to you and test for the flu, Covid-19, food poisoning, pregnancy, and 10 other things all at once. The results come in 15 minutes, then you could get what you need or teleconference a doctor.\u201d<\/span><\/p>\n<p><span style=\"font-weight: 400\">ASG is currently able to produce about 2,000 of its sensors on 8-inch chips per production line in its partner\u2019s semiconductor foundry. As the company continues scaling up production, Black is hopeful the sensors will lower costs at every step between drug developers and patients.<\/span><\/p>\n<p><span style=\"font-weight: 400\">\u201cWe really want to lower the barriers for testing so that everyone has access to good health care,\u201d Black says. \u201cBeyond that, there are so many applications for protein sensing.
